North Berwick LNER 1923 - National Railway Museum Cushion Fabric choice:Cotton Linen known for its striking goldenThe cushion is produced for the London & North Eastern Railway (LNER) to promote rail travel to the seaside resort of North Berwick on the east coast of Scotland. The cushion shows a young woman in a bathing costume, pouring tea from a thermos flask into cups, for herself and two companions, who are shown reclining on the sand. The man has a bag of golf clubs by his side. Artwork by Frank Newbould (1887 1951), who studied at Bradford College of Art
